Output eba26adea4b5e7e11a98417434bd038557482d7d04aaf581b8272196dbbf8720:23

value
187000
script pubkey
OP_0 OP_PUSHBYTES_20 39040b8f711720d0e24cb78c96795647f45f61b2
address
bc1q8yzqhrm3zusdpcjvk7xfv72kgl697cdjwn8y7v
transaction
eba26adea4b5e7e11a98417434bd038557482d7d04aaf581b8272196dbbf8720
spent
true